Transaction 3995e87e16f559812514ebd42bc72d8e5c772a56dc60d08af09e8488b9a54beb
1 Input
1 Output
-
3995e87e16f559812514ebd42bc72d8e5c772a56dc60d08af09e8488b9a54beb:0
- value
- 132763594
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 27ba9970a3d8e4f21cbb8851454ee034005a5db1 OP_EQUAL
- address
- 35K5pBDiMMy1ztytbYWWvjgrLg6R4eEDiW